Abstract

Gazellah Bruder is an artist based in Port Moresby, Papua New Guinea. She presents four paintings she created while an artist-in-residence (August to October 2025) in the Leipzig International Art program at the Leipziger Baumwollspinnerei in Germany. In an artist statement, Bruder describes how her paintings are inspired by conversations surrounding complex subjects—colonization, de-colonization, identity, and restitution—and presents a critique of the devastating human impact on the earth’s oceans and ocean life. Her work calls for restitution to the oceans. Then, in an interview with art historian Stacy L. Kamehiro, Bruder discusses the four paintings and her artistic process in detail.
